The assessment process was intensive and time-consuming (approximately 5 days of effort). While the team was responsive, the case interview round lacked clear structure and predefined problem framing.
The hiring manager introduced an API-related scenario with loosely defined requirements, which made it difficult to understand evaluation criteria upfront. Candidates should be prepared to spend time clarifying assumptions before proposing solutions, as structured requirement gathering appears to be heavily weighted.
The process involved multiple technically demanding rounds with high expectations around architecture thinking and tooling depth. However, clarity around evaluation benchmarks and decision criteria felt limited. Communication cadence did not always align with the stated turnaround time, creating uncertainty during the process. The experience felt disproportionately rigorous relative to the transparency provided about role scope and growth trajectory.
Overall, expect ambiguity and ensure you explicitly articulate your thought process before moving into implementation.